Martha Stewart Baking Handbook Book Review

Martha Stewart, the domestic diva, has culled her years of knowledge and expertise into a baking bible. The baking handbook is divided into sections based on type of baked good - from simple baked goods like muffins to more intermediate recipes for pastries and breads. Martha''s authoritative and informative tone is noted throughout the book. Each chapter contains tips and techniques for better baking and advises bakers on the different types of utensils and equipment needed. The cookbook even illustrates basic how-tos in a step-by-step manner.

Beginners will easily learn how to bake cookies and quick breads, while more intermediate bakers will perhaps try a new cake recipe or improve their technique with tips from Martha. The delicious recipes are tried and tested by the Martha Stewart Living staff. Most recipes are accompanied with beautiful photographs of the finished product.

The Martha Stewart Baking Handbook will no doubt inspire anyone to bake a batch of delicious treats. It is a useful and comprehensive baking book that any baker will surely turn to for many years to come.
